StrongRoom AI will live on under new management with Queensland pharmacy entrepreneur Joe Zhou acquiring the Melbourne healthtech startup from the administrators in a deal finalised late on Thursday. EVP has added 20 more defendants, including earlier VC investors – taking the total to 32 – in its legal action to recover $10.4 million invested in StrongRoom AI. EVP has lodged legal action in the Federal Court of Australia in a bid to recoup the $10.44 million it invested in Melbourne startup StrongRoom AI. Financiers for Melbourne startup Strongroom AI have forced the company into administration, amid concerns about the company’s accounts. The move comes after the lead investor, EVP called in police on Monday after asking for its money back following a $17 million raise in early March. The request was declined by StrongRoom.
